A bad experience I visited Roccos Sat Feb 4 2006 with my wife and 2 young kids (2 & 5). We arrived at 5.20pm and didn't get served until 6.00pm despite the resturant being only 10% full. We prompted the waitress twice because my 2 yr old was getting hungry and eventually got the appetizer after 40 mins (plain garlic bread. One of the pizzas then arrived cold and the wrong soup was served. No deserts were available as 'they haven't been delivered yet'. The manager's attitude was dismissive, stating they were busy with take out orders. I was promised a discount which amounted to 2 soft drinks and 1 portion of garlic bread! Overall, this was a poor experience that I won't be repeating. [05 Feb 2006 07:21:25]

A good experience - Change in ownership and quality Having been to Rocco's in the past and not having enjoyed it, we were hesitant when a friend suggested that we try it again as there had been a change in ownership. My wife and I are certainly glad that we took the chance. Every time we have been there we have thoroughly enjoyed the food, atmosphere, and service. The menu is quite varied and we have yet to have anything that is sub-par. The wait staff is friendly and accomodating and do not appear to get flustered at anything happening outside the norm. We have been going there once or twice a month since the end of 2006 and see no reason to stop. [11 May 2007 07:24:34]
